There's a team who's better at losing than the Kings!

And that team is the Boston Celtics.

I only caught the fourth quarter, so:

  1. The Ronhawk is awesome in every way imaginable. This includes the fact that it was Mike Bibby who performed the barbery.
  2. Kevin Martin's fourth: 12 pts, 5-5 shooting.
  3. That shutdown defense we've seen in spurts from Francisco Garcia? It's real.
It's almost like Musselman said: "Kevin, you score. Francisco, you shut down West. Everyone else, don't do anything stupid." Guess what? It worked! Cheers for that.

Long live the Ronhawk.
